Stay Secure With the 'Yu-Gi-Oh!' Millenium Puzzle Phone Ring Holder

Launching the Kaiba Corporation Store last year, Yu-Gi-Oh! is continuing to deliver playful items on the platform. Fans of the trading card game and series can now pick up a “Millenium Puzzle Phone Ring Holder.”

Helping you stay secure, the functional accessory is constructed of a gold-tone zinc alloy and expresses the face of the iconic Millenium Item. Additional detailing comes in the form of a gem at the Millenium Eye and a matching ring outfitted at the top. Attached with an adhesive backing, the ring can be worn on the finger or used to prop up a phone on a stable surface.

Priced at ¥1,650 JPY (approximately $95 USD), the Yu-Gi-Oh! Millenium Puzzle Phone Ring Holder is available now for pre-order at the Kaiba Corporation Store, with shipping expected for early December.
